LINUX.ORG.RU

Сообщения calebfedorov

 

Поиск отсутствуюших записей

Форум — Development

Есть таблица, а в ней id, но некоторых заисей нет и их надо найти, пока тупо перебираю:


while True:
	lastid = lastid-1
	cur.execute("select * from files where id = ?", [lastid])
	if not cur.fetchone():
		return lastid

Так работает, но некрасиво и долго, а как одим запросом все выбрать?

PS id не AUTOINCREMENT и идет не с 1

 ,

calebfedorov
()

RSS подписка на новые темы